Default GSR Swap - Hesitation when cold

Just a quick question, I have a EG Hatch with a B18c Swap and everything is running great....except when its cold. For the first 10-20 minutes it'll have huge amounts of hesitation through 3-5k rpms...almost like its flooded w/ fuel or somthing...any suggestions on how to diagnose this?

Default Re: GSR Swap - Hesitation when cold (eg-gsr)

Check your o2 sensor. On my Golf a few years ago I put in a non heated o2 and until car warmed up it ran like crap. After installing a heated one it ran fine. Also check cold start circuit of fuel injection system as indicated in manual.
